SENATE JOINT RESOLUTION NO. 271

Offered January 14, 2025

Proposing an amendment to the Constitution of Virginia by adding in Article I a section numbered 11-A, relating to the right to work.

RESOLVED by the Senate, the House of Delegates concurring, a majority of the members elected to each house agreeing, That the following amendment to the Constitution of Virginia be, and the same hereby is, proposed and referred to the General Assembly at its first regular session held after the next general election of members of the House of Delegates for its concurrence in conformity with the provisions of Section 1 of Article XII of the Constitution of Virginia, namely:

Amend the Constitution of Virginia by adding in Article I a section numbered 11-A as follows:

ARTICLE I

BILL OF RIGHTS

Section 11-A. Right to work.

That it is unlawful for any person, corporation, association, or this Commonwealth or any of its political subdivisions to deny or attempt to deny employment to any person because of such person's membership in, affiliation with, resignation from, or refusal to join or affiliate with any labor union or employee organization.
